Lunch Lady Brownies Recipe: Old-fashioned Frosted Chocolate Brownies

Remember going through the lunch line at school and seeing a tray of frosted chocolate brownies? It probably made your whole day! Relive that childhood experience by making a batch of these easy lunch lady brownies. This easy frosted chocolate brownie recipe is ooey, gooey and topped with a creamy chocolate frosting. So good!

The brownie batter is made with melted butter, unsweetened cocoa powder, all-purpose flour, granulated sugar, eggs and vanilla extract. The batter is baked in the oven until just set. The creamy chocolate frosting is made with butter, milk, unsweetened cocoa powder, vanilla extract and powdered sugar. The creamy frosting is spread on the warm (not hot!) brownies.

Serve these old-fashioned lunch lady brownies for a snack or dessert when you need that chocolate fix – or just want to reminisce.

Cuisine: American
Prep Time: 10 minutes plus time to cool 
Cook Time: 25 minutes
Total Time: 35 minutes plus time to cool
Servings: 20

Ingredients

Frosting 

  • 4 tablespoons butter, softened
  • 1/4 cup milk
  • 1/4 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on vanilla
  • 3 cups powdered sugar

Helpful Products

Recipe Notes

  • Store the brownies in an airtight container to keep them moist.
  • Make sure the brownies are warm, not hot out of the oven, when spreading on the frosting.

Here's how to make it: 

  1. Combine the melted butter and cocoa powder in a bowl. Beat with an electric mixer until smooth. Add the granulated sugar, flour, eggs and vanilla. Beat until combined. 
  2. Pour the batter into a parchment paper-lined 13x9-inch baking pan. Bake in a preheated 350-degree F oven for about 25 minutes or until brownies are set. Remove to cool. 
  3. To make the frosting, combine all the ingredients in a bowl. Beat with an electric mixer until smooth and spreadable. Spread the frosting over the warm (not hot!) brownies. Refrigerate until cooled, then cut into squares.
